Meopham Station is well-equipped to meet the needs of travelers, with its key amenities ensuring convenience and comfort for all. The station operates a ticket office, open from Monday to Friday between 06:15 and 12:45 and on Saturdays from 08:00 to 13:15. For those preferring a more digital approach, ticket machines are readily available, allowing you to collect tickets purchased online with ease.
This station is recognized for its secure station accreditation, and CCTV is in operation to offer travelers peace of mind. For additional support, a help point is onsite for immediate assistance, and staff are generally on hand during ticket office hours. While step-free access is available to Platform 1 for services towards London, travelers should be aware that this convenience does not extend to Platform 2, where access is solely via steps.
Car parking is managed by APCOA Parking and is available 24/7. There are a total of 167 spaces, with six designated for accessible parking. Bicycle enthusiasts can find sheltered storage spaces at the station, though you leave bikes at your own risk as CCTV coverage is not available for the cycle stands.

The station offers only the bare essentials when it comes to facilities. While it lacks a ticket office and ticket machines, you can still secure your rail tickets conveniently online. For those needing assistance, the station is devoid of on-site staff, but help is always accessible through the helpline on 08002006060.
Accessibility is an important consideration here. Being a Category B station, step-free access is available in parts of the station, notably via barrow crossing. While this ensures ease of movement, amenities such as induction loops and customer help points provide added support to passengers with additional needs. However, bear in mind that there are no accessible toilets or substantial seating areas.
